						August 21, 2014
						Capmark, Ex-CEO Ink Secret Pact In $17M Compensation SuitReorganized real estate lender Capmark Financial Group Inc. on Tuesday asked for approval of a settlement over $16.7 million in disputed stock redemption and severance payments its former president and CEO William F. Aldinger III collected following his resignation, though it is keeping the deal's terms a secret.

						September 23, 2013
						Capmark's Confirmed Ch. 11 Plan Bars Fillmore's $50M SuitCapmark Financial Group Inc.'s confirmed Chapter 11 plan discharged a breach of contract claim filed in New York state court by one of Fillmore Capital Partners' units over a loan secured by a mall and hotel complex, a Delaware bankruptcy judge ruled Monday.

						August 23, 2013
						Wells Fargo Settles $28M Swaps Suit Against CapmarkCapmark Financial Group Inc. asked a Delaware bankruptcy judge Friday to bless a settlement resolving a $28 million suit brought by Wells Fargo Bank NA over swaps deals that went south when the mortgage lender entered court protection in 2009.

						January 23, 2012
						Ex-Capmark CEO Sued For $17M Over Stock Redemption PaymentsCapmark Financial Group Inc. on Monday launched an adversary suit against its former President and CEO William F. Aldinger III and related trusts, seeking recovery of approximately $16.7 million in stock redemption payments it made to him following his resignation.

						December 06, 2011
						Wells Fargo Seeks $5.6M From Capmark In Ch. 11 CaseWells Fargo Bank NA hit newly reorganized Capmark Finance LLC with an adversary suit Tuesday in Delaware bankruptcy court, seeking a judgment that it is entitled to a $5.6 million unsecured claim against the mortgage lender.

						July 13, 2011
						Capmark Ducks $2M Claim Over Mortgage ServicingThe bankruptcy judge overseeing Capmark Financial Group Inc.'s reorganization in Delaware on Wednesday rejected National Life Insurance Co.'s bid to recover more than $2 million relating to mortgage loans the debtor serviced.

						July 06, 2011
						Capmark Creditors Cleared To Vote On Ch. 11 PlanA Delaware bankruptcy judge gave his blessing on Wednesday to the disclosure statement explaining Capmark Financial Group Inc.'s reorganization plan, allowing the commercial mortgage lender to put the plan to creditors for a vote.

						May 31, 2011
						Capmark Grants $2.4B In Unsecured Loan ClaimsCapmark Financial Group Inc. on Tuesday clinched an agreement with Wilmington Trust FSB that grants the trustee roughly $2.4 billion in unsecured claims under the bankrupt lender's latest Chapter 11 plan in Delaware.

						May 25, 2011
						US Bancorp, JPMorgan Rip Capmark's DisclosureJPMorgan Chase Bank NA and U.S. Bancorp objected to Capmark Financial Group Inc.'s disclosure statement explaining its Chapter 11 plan Tuesday in Delaware, saying the bankrupt commercial mortgage lender needs to better explain its unsecured claims estimates and third-party releases.
